Description

The JVC SR-W320U is the original first-generation W-VHS HDTV recorder/player. It records and plays back high-definition "Hi-vision" baseband signals in W-VHS HD mode using a rotary 4-head helical scanning system, and supports standard-definition recording in W-VHS SD mode using temporal compression (TCI) with a rotary 2-head system. The unit is fully backward-compatible with VHS and S-VHS cassettes for conventional recording and playback. At an MSRP of $9,850, it was the most expensive model in JVC's W-VHS lineup, positioned above the later JVC SR-W7U ($6,069) and JVC SR-W5U ($4,890). Unlike the 3rd-generation SR-W7U, the SR-W320U uses RS-232C serial control (rather than RS-422A) and does not include SMPTE timecode or D-sub 15-pin RGB output. Its composite video connections use professional BNC connectors rather than RCA. The unit includes HD component (YPbPr) input and output for Hi-vision signals, along with S-Video and composite connections for standard-definition content. A monaural audio input (left channel only) is available on the front panel. JVC's case history records the SR-W320U in a Communicore partnership that helped deliver early HDTV programming. The compatible KH-100U-CB 3-CCD self-contained HDTV camera ($62,500) was listed as a companion accessory. The SR-W320U features a built-in timer capable of 8 programs over 2 weeks with a 24-hour clock system. Power consumption is 78 W during operation (10 W standby).

Recording Formats

Mode System Heads
W-VHS HD mode Rotary helical scan 4-head
W-VHS SD mode Rotary helical scan, TCI temporal compression FM recording 2-head
S-VHS / VHS Rotary helical scan, luminance FM / color phase-shift sub-carrier 2-head

HiFi Audio

Parameter Value
Recording system VHS stereo HiFi
Frequency response 20 Hz – 20 kHz
Dynamic range ≥90 dB
Wow & flutter ≤0.005%
Channel separation ≥60 dB

A secondary linear monaural audio track is also available. The front panel provides a monaural audio input (left channel only, RCA) for dubbing convenience.

Timer

The built-in timer supports 8 programs over a 2-week period using a 24-hour clock system. Battery backup provides approximately 30 minutes of clock retention during power loss.
